Tender description
Objectives: - Assess the accessibility of four DWP sites for people who are deaf, have hearing loss, or tinnitus. - Make recommendations for improvements to these sites. - Provide best practice recommendations for the entire DWP estate. - Advise on modifications to existing DWP design guidance and GPA guidance to improve the accessibility of the DWP estate for the deaf and hard of hearing community. Pre-Visit Preparation: - DWP will identify four sites to be visited, including two variations of Job Centre Plus, one hub, and one service centre. - RNID and DWP will mutually agree on the selected sites. - DWP will provide RNID with relevant materials for each site, including floor plans, details of space usage, specific areas of focus, and arrival information. - Approximately one week before the first site visit, RNID and DWP will have a pre-visit call to ensure all necessary information has been shared and an agenda for the day is agreed upon. Site Visits: - A team of two specialist RNID representatives (one technology specialist and one specialist in accessible workplaces) will conduct approximately a 3-hour site visit at each of the agreed sites. - They will evaluate the environment for both colleagues and visitors, focusing on assistive technology, the suitability of the working environment, the acoustic quality of the working environment in comparison to contemporary thinking, and other accessibility-related factors. - Each visit will focus on a few representative rooms at each site.
